The ahistorical ammunition (DM63) was reported and refused, being cited as a balance factor. The XM800T is at BR 8.7 because Gaijin wants to maintain it in its current position in the TT, and the artificially inflated firepower via DM63 is deemed necessary for this.

Doesn’t make sense to me, there is clearly space in Rank V for a 2nd light tank at 7.7 or 8.0, which would leave 2 light tanks in Rank VI. At present the XM800T’s BR overshadows the M3 Bradley’s 8.3, meaning players unlock an 8.7 vehicle before an 8.3 vehicle.

I will never understand the insistence that some people have which asks for reconnaissance vehicles to always have a means of killing heavy tanks, save for a complete ignorance of military doctrine.

That’s not what the XM800T was meant to fight. The 20 mm is for unarmoured and lightly armoured ground target, helicopters, infantry, materiel, etc. Light tanks kill heavy tanks by scouting them for their teammates.
